Uninstalling SonicStage
To uninstall the supplied software from your computer, follow the procedure
below.
Click “Start”– “Control Panel.”
1)
Double-click “Add/Remove Programs.”
2)
Click “SonicStage X.X” in the “Currently Installed Programs” list, and
then click “Remove.”
Follow the displayed instruction and restart your computer.
The uninstallation is completed when the computer has restarted.
1)
“Settings” – “Control Panel” in the case of Windows 2000 Professional.
2)
“Change/Remove” in the case of Windows 2000 Professional.
Note
When you install SonicStage, “OpenMG Secure Module” is installed at the same time. Do
not delete “OpenMG Secure Module” since it may be used by other software.
